the dual springs are designed to allow higher spring pressure while still allowing large lift..... the only thing is with higher pressure springs you can flatten out the cam easier.... the benefit of higher pressure springs is that they slam the valves shut quicker.... which is especially good if you have a large overlap..... gets the valve shut as quick as it can be allowedjust because your car is faster, doesn't mean i cant outdrive you... give me a curvy mountain road and i'll beat you any day
